clyster

clys·ter

UK/ˈklɪstə/ US/ˈklɪstɚ/ uncommon archaic

noun

1.

injection of a liquid through the anus to stimulate evacuation; sometimes used for diagnostic purposes

Synonyms

Origin

From Middle French clystere, or its Latin source, in turn from Ancient Greek κλυστήρ (klustḗr).
